Neutron scattering study of atomic local order in amorphous Tbsub(x)Sisub(1-x) (x= 0.87, 0.59, 0.18)

Description
Neutron scattering determination of the total structure factors of the amorphous Tbsub(x)Sisub(1-x) system has been performed for three compositions in order to determine the atomic arrangement and the evolution of the local order as a function of the silicon content. Comparison has been made with a conventional structural model consisting of a binary mixture of hard spheres of different diameters. Total pair correlation functions have been determined. We propose a model for the local order around both the terbium and the silicon atoms which is in reasonable agreement with the physical properties of the system. (author)
